The West Washington County District 10 School Board met last Thursday, and following a hearing, approved the budget for the coming school year. Superintendent Scott Fuhrhop said the budget as presented was balanced.

“In the education fund, we’re deficit spending by $55,000, but the rest of that was made up in gains from the other funds, so it’s a balanced budget altogether,” said Fuhrhop.
In personnel matters, the board hired Cameron Obermeier as junior varsity girls basketball coach, Taylor Keller as the fifth and sixth grade boys basketball coach, and Darci Siliven was hired full-time at Okawville Grade School. “We hired Darci Siliven from half-time EC to full time because of our numbers,” said Fuhrhop. “We’re at 11 now, so we had to go full time on that.”
The board also approved the Application for School Recognition and the Teacher and Administration Salary and Benefits Report as required by the Illinois State Board of Education. The next meeting is scheduled for October 27.
